Top public schools in Turner

4 schools tracked · 1,476 students

The largest public schools serving Turner, ME by enrollment, drawn from the National Center for Education Statistics. School quality is a commonly cited factor in home-buying decisions — these are the campuses families in this area are most likely to encounter.

Leavitt Area High School

Grades 9-12 · 565 students

Public

Tripp Middle School

Grades 7-8 · 326 students

Public

Turner Primary School

Grades PK-2 · 310 students

Public

Turner Elementary School

Grades 3-6 · 275 students

Public

Source: National Center for Education Statistics, Common Core of Data directory. Updated annually. Ratings and test scores are not currently displayed.
